Key Features of Firebase Crashlytics
Firebase Crashlytics offers several key features that make it an indispensable tool for app developers:
1. Real-Time Crash Reporting
Crashlytics provides real-time crash reporting, allowing developers to instantly receive crash reports as they occur, including details on the affected devices, OS versions, and the sequence of events leading to the crash.
2. Prioritization of Crashes
Crashlytics automatically prioritizes crashes based on the frequency of occurrence and the impact on users. This helps developers address the most critical issues first.
3. Detailed Crash Insights
Developers gain access to detailed crash insights, including stack traces, logs, and user data. This information is invaluable for diagnosing and fixing issues quickly.
4. Integration with Firebase Analytics
Crashlytics seamlessly integrates with Firebase Analytics, allowing developers to correlate crash data with user behavior and app events, providing a complete picture of the issue’s context.

Getting Started with Firebase Crashlytics
Getting started with Firebase Crashlytics is straightforward and involves the following steps:
1. Firebase Project Setup
Create or use an existing Firebase project in the Firebase Console and enable Crashlytics in the project settings.
2. SDK Integration
Integrate the Firebase Crashlytics SDK into your app by adding the required dependencies and initializing the SDK in your app code.
3. Monitoring Crashes
Once integrated, Firebase Crashlytics will automatically begin monitoring crashes and reporting them in the Firebase Console.
4. Issue Resolution
Review crash reports in the Firebase Console, prioritize and address the most critical issues, and track the resolution progress.
